Heavy Industry, Smarter Cooling: How the Industrial Dry Cooler Market Enhances Plant Reliability

0
4

Understand how the industrial dry cooler market provides fail-safe heat rejection for heavy manufacturing, often paired with air-cooled heat exchangers for critical processes.

Heavy industries such as steel, cement, petrochemicals, and plastics generate enormous thermal loads that cannot be rejected to water bodies without costly permits. The industrial dry cooler market offers a closed-loop solution that isolates process fluids from the atmosphere, preventing contamination while rejecting heat efficiently. These systems are designed for high ambient temperatures, dusty environments, and continuous operation—sometimes running 8,000 hours per year between overhauls. Unlike open cooling towers that can become breeding grounds for bacteria, industrial dry coolers maintain fluid integrity, reducing fouling in heat exchangers and extending equipment life. For plant engineers, the reliability gains are as important as water savings.

A key feature of the industrial dry cooler market is modular scalability. Multiple dry cooler units can be banked together and controlled by a central manifold, allowing facilities to match cooling capacity to production demand. This is particularly valuable in industries with seasonal or batch processes, such as chemical batch reactors or injection molding lines. Additionally, dry coolers operate independently of water treatment infrastructure, which means no chemical storage, no blowdown disposal, and no risk of freezing in winter shutdowns. In remote mining operations, this self-sufficiency is a major logistical advantage. Modern units also include sound-attenuated housings and low-noise fans, making them suitable for sites with strict noise ordinances.

When integrated with the air cooled heat exchanger market , industrial dry coolers form the backbone of dry cooling systems. For example, a refinery might use air-cooled heat exchangers for high-temperature process streams and dry coolers for closed-loop cooling of compressors and hydraulic oil. This combination eliminates cooling water entirely, reducing a facility's water footprint by millions of liters annually. Advanced control strategies, such as variable frequency drives and ambient temperature setpoint reset, further optimize energy use. Predictive maintenance sensors can detect fan bearing wear or coil fouling, alerting teams before a shutdown occurs. The industrial dry cooler market continues to grow as heavy industries face water restrictions, proving that air-based cooling can match or exceed the reliability of wet systems.
